WENGER GST by Victorinox Swiss Made Ref. 7823X
This timepiece is perfect for a daily routine!. It is a Wenger GST by Victorinox wristwatch reference 7823X.
The watch is equipped with a Swiss quartz movement and it has a fresh battery.
It has a silver textured dial with blue Arabic Numerals, luminous hour marks. blue minute/seconds track and blue luminous matching hand. The white date window is located at 3 o'clock.
Cased in a 39.8mm round and casual case design, all in stainless steel. Unidirectional rotating bezel. Water-resistant 100m (330 ft.), sapphire crystal.
The watch is coming with the original stainless steel bracelet and it will fit a wrist up to 6 3/4" (17.2 cm).

Vintage watches are traditionally smaller than today's watches. Men’s watches typically measure between 29-36mm wide (some larger, some smaller) excluding the crown.
